About Green Valley Estates North, San Diego
Green Valley Estates North, San Diego, California sits in the heart of North County's Poway corridor, offering suburban family living at relatively accessible price points. Located near ZIP code 92064 and bordered by Espola Road to the west and Pomerado Road to the east, this residential neighborhood provides a quiet retreat from San Diego's urban intensity while maintaining reasonable commute access to employment centers.
Young families and first-time homebuyers gravitate to Green Valley Estates North for its proximity to Poway High School, larger lot sizes, and peaceful suburban atmosphere. While the neighborhood requires car dependency for daily errands, residents appreciate the combination of affordability, safety, and access to quality North County amenities without paying premium coastal prices.
Green Valley Estates North Real Estate Market 2026
Green Valley Estates North reflects broader San Diego County trends with median prices around $899K and homes selling in approximately 27 days. Buyers have more negotiating room than peak years, with most homes selling near list price rather than above.
Expect 1-3 competing offers on well-priced single-family homes, typically at or slightly below asking with standard contingencies and 30-day close
San Diego County has seen steady appreciation over recent years, with some cooling in 2026 providing more balanced conditions for buyers.
Source: Redfin San Diego County, Q1 2026

Schools Near Green Valley Estates North, San Diego
Green Valley Estates North falls within Poway Unified School District boundaries, providing access to Painted Rock Elementary (79.0 rating) and Poway High School (61.0 rating). While not the highest-rated district options, these schools offer solid education at a more affordable neighborhood price point.
